Demystifying AI and Machine Learning

Before we delve into the remarkable applications of AI machine learning, it’s essential to understand the fundamentals of these two closely intertwined concepts. Artificial intelligence (AI) refers to the development of computer systems that can perform tasks typically requiring human intelligence, such as decision-making, visual perception, and language understanding. Machine learning, a subset of AI, involves training algorithms to recognize patterns and make predictions based on data inputs without explicit programming.

Key Techniques in Machine Learning

Various techniques and approaches are used in machine learning to enable machines to learn from data. Some of the most prominent methods include:

  1. Supervised Learning: The algorithm is trained on labeled data, learning the relationship between input features and target outputs. Once trained, the model can make predictions for new, unseen data.
  2. Unsupervised Learning: The algorithm learns from unlabelled data by identifying patterns and structures within the dataset. Common applications include clustering and dimensionality reduction.
  3. Reinforcement Learning: The algorithm learns through trial and error by interacting with an environment and receiving feedback in the form of rewards or penalties.

Transformative Applications of AI Machine Learning

AI machine learning is already making a significant impact in numerous industries. Here, we explore some of the most notable applications:

  • Healthcare: AI machine learning is revolutionizing diagnostics, drug discovery, and personalized medicine. By analyzing vast amounts of data, algorithms can detect early signs of diseases, streamline treatment plans, and even predict patient outcomes.
  • Finance: Machine learning algorithms are being used to detect fraudulent transactions, assess credit risk, and automate trading strategies. These applications lead to increased security, efficiency, and profitability in the finance sector.
  • Manufacturing: AI-powered machines can optimize production processes, identify defects, and improve overall efficiency. By automating repetitive tasks, machine learning is reducing human error and streamlining the manufacturing industry.
  • Transportation: The development of self-driving cars is a prime example of AI machine learning at work. By processing vast amounts of data from sensors and cameras, these vehicles can navigate complex environments and improve traffic flow.

Challenges and Ethical Considerations

Despite its immense potential, AI machine learning also presents several challenges and ethical concerns:

  1. Data Privacy and Security: The collection and analysis of vast amounts of data can raise privacy concerns, as well as the potential for data breaches and misuse.
  2. Bias and Fairness: Machine learning models can inadvertently perpetuate existing biases in data, leading to unfair treatment of certain groups or individuals.
  3. Job Displacement: The automation of tasks through AI machine learning may result in job displacement for some workers, necessitating retraining and reskilling programs.
  4. Explainability: As machine learning models become more complex, it can be challenging to understand and explain their decision-making processes, leading to a potential lack of transparency and accountability.
